new paragraphI have two Yamaha XJ900F motorcycles, this one and an older (1991 vintage) XJ900F. This XJ however, is black and purple coloured and bought in Spring 1994. This one has been protected from me and only done 3800 miles! Mostly in dry weather too - except for the day I collected it when it rained!
Theres not much I can say about this particular bike really - except its clean! Like the older bike, I also carry out most of the maintenance to it myself and any major jobs are dealt with by Mount Motorcycles of Port Talbot.

new paragraphIn fairness to this bike, I havent had any problems at all with it. But to be truthful, it hasnt really gone anywhere so havent had the "time" to experience any problems! Like the older XJ, I have started to maintain the brake callipers just to prevent any furture problems I might encounter with cracking brake discs because the pistons seize if they get dirty.

new paragraphOne thing I have learnt from the older XJ, is that the front suspension on this model is too bouncy and so I have upgraded the fork springs for touring strength springs. Why Yamaha decided to remove the Anti-dive mechanism on my two bikes Im not sure.

new paragraphAlso, like the older bike, I have also fitted extra spot lights, Fiamm snail horns (very loud!) and Givi pannier luggage racks and engine crash bars. Oh, and an alarm.
